This is a song written and sung by my friend Kerry Kennington aka Carlos Machiste of Austin's KOKE-FM fame.
I played the fiddle parts and keyboard played Trumpets (NI Session Horns Pro) Chad Ware of Rick Trevino and Janie Fricke fame played the Electric Guitar verse fills and solo.
Biab 2019 Style used: Andele Amplitude Tex-Mex Polka All tracks are Real Tracks Exported to DAW parts: Drums, Bass, Accordion, Electric Rhythm Guitar
DAW used: Mixbus 5 FX Used: Drums-Mighty Mite compressor in channel Reverb on most tracks: Overloud Breverb on stereo bus Mastered with Ozone 8 Bossa preset

It's a cool Tex Mex feel - I reckon it'd be very Ry Cooder, (Chicken Skin Music era ), if it was slower. The vocals & horns are pretty hot playing it as a streamer. To check things I downloaded the file & opened it in Reaper - it clips very, very frequently. It runs particularly hot in the intro and even after frequently hits + while sitting at no level increase on the track and the master bus. It fares a little better when converted to .wav and opened in Wave-repair but it looks like it was compressed and then normalized or brick wall limited.
